  • ABOUT THE COMPANY Mud Bay Drilling has built a reputation based on trust and experience.
  • Since 1972, we've delivered information through drilling, sampling and in-situ testing on geotechnical, environmental and exploration projects.
  • We continue to offer the highest quality services in a safe, reliable and cost-effective manner.

Requirements

  • A successful candidate must have the ability to multi-task with an eye for efficiency and a safety mindset.
  • High School Diploma required.
  • Experience Requirements
  • Ability to work in mining and oil & gas environments.
  • Must be able to perform physically demanding tasks, including lifting, moving heavy materials up to 50 lbs, climbing, crawling as well as walking on uneven ground, and working long hours in all weather conditions.
  • Provide timely assistance to Engineers and Technicians as required.
  • Driver's license (minimum Class 5) and clean driving record.
  • Commercial driver's license an asset.
  • Having experience as a driller or driller's helper experience related to geotechnical or mud rotary drilling a huge asset.
